Financial Performance - The company's operating revenue for the first half of 2020 was ¥528,231,935.81, a decrease of 18.05% compared to ¥644,542,877.50 in the same period last year[18]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ders of the listed company was -¥17,604,318.75, representing a decline of 163.35% from ¥27,787,133.20 in the previous year[18]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ders after deducting non-recurring gains and losses was -¥23,956,625.80, a decrease of 327.56% compared to ¥10,527,491.92 in the same period last year[18]. - The net cash flow from operating activities was -¥125,149,763.95, which is a 34.12% increase in loss compared to -¥93,312,296.97 in the previous year[18]. - The basic earnings per share were -¥0.0526, down 163.45% from ¥0.0829 in the same period last year[18]. - Total assets at the end of the reporting period were ¥3,492,843,648.90, a decrease of 1.92% from ¥3,561,087,508.54 at the end of the previous year[18]. - The net assets attributable to shareholders of the listed company were ¥1,907,922,195.10, down 3.12% from ¥1,969,412,190.31 at the end of the previous year[18]. - The company reported total operating revenue of RMB 528.23 million, a decline of 18.05% compared to the previous year, primarily due to delays in shipments and reduced order volume caused by the pandemic[45]. - The net profit for the first half of 2020 was a loss of CNY 14.63 million, compared to a profit of CNY 30.31 million in the first half of 2019, representing a significant decline[152]. - The total comprehensive income for the first half of 2020 was a loss of CNY 14.63 million, compared to a gain of CNY 30.31 million in the same period of 2019[152]. Research and Development - Research and development expenses increased by 103.12% to RMB 19.53 million, reflecting a commitment to enhance R&D efforts during the reporting period[45]. - The company has developed a competitive edge through advanced production technology and a focus on R&D of new products and technologies[31]. - The company has a robust R&D team with over 30 senior researchers, including 2 PhDs, enhancing its independent research capabilities[33]. - The company has developed a new product, the DN710/1.6MPa PVC water supply pipe, which is leading in the domestic market[32]. Market Position and Strategy - The company has maintained its position as the leading producer of prestressed concrete pipes (PCCP) in China for five consecutive years from 2015 to 2019[29]. - The company has established itself as a leading player in the water supply and drainage pipe industry, being the only enterprise in China with a comprehensive range of concrete, plastic, and steel pipe products[34]. - The company has actively participated in industry alliances, such as the "Quality Innovation Alliance for Prestressed Concrete Pipes," to enhance its market position and technological collaboration[33]. - The company aims to mitigate risks from raw material price fluctuations by optimizing supply channels and promoting new technologies[72]. - The company is focusing on technological advancements and automation to enhance production efficiency amid rising raw material costs[71].
